Significant discoveries around ... Web31 okt. 2024 · Geothermal energy is natural heat from the interior of the earth that can be used to generate electricity as well as to heat up buildings. Below the earth’s crust, there is a layer of hot and molten rock, called magma. Heat is continually produced in this layer, mostly from the decay of naturally radioactive materials such as uranium and potassium.
